Short answer: A DataReader is a forward-only, read-only cursor, meaning it streams data from the database and does not store the entire result set in memory. DataSet, on the other hand, loads the entire result set into memory, which can consume significant memory for large datasets.

Short answer: Optimistic Concurrency assumes that conflicts will be rare and allows multiple users to read and modify data without locking it.
When updating data, you compare the current data in the database with the data the user fetched earlier (usually by checking a timestamp or version number). If the data has been changed by someone else, you throw a concurrency exception. Steps: Add a timestamp or row version column to the table. When updating, check if the timestamp or row version has changed.
SqlCommand command = new SqlCommand("UPDATE Customers SET CustomerName = @CustomerName WHERE CustomerID = @CustomerID AND RowVersion = @RowVersion", connection); command.Parameters.AddWithValue("@CustomerName", customerName); command.Parameters.AddWithValue("@CustomerID", customerId); command.Parameters.AddWithValue("@RowVersion", rowVersion); If the RowVersion has changed between the time the user fetched the data and the time they attempt to update, the update will fail, and an exception will be thrown.

Short answer: ADO.NET (Active Data Objects .NET) is a data access technology in the .NET framework that enables applications to interact with databases and other data sources.
It provides a set of classes for connecting to databases, retrieving data, manipulating data, and updating data. ADO.NET is designed for disconnected data access, meaning that data can be retrieved, modified, and worked with without maintaining an ongoing connection to the database. Real-Time Example: In a C# application, ADO.NET is used to retrieve a list of products from a database and display it in a UI like a GridView. The data is fetched from the database, stored in a DataSet or DataTable, and then bound to the UI controls.
